Output 7c3ecc519e8599017e8565d8c393e024ce5857d95d1cd8c7486e95f554d2f821:0

value
659874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c4c525a1ba0fda9c6e954946792ba150be52f11 OP_EQUAL
address
3JrePXnqGd7Mr9dvU8iQtwK6Ww8Apgf3MM
transaction
7c3ecc519e8599017e8565d8c393e024ce5857d95d1cd8c7486e95f554d2f821
spent
true